Birmingham 1900 solid silver leaf and scroll engraved vesta case in very good condition. |
| Birmingham 1900 English hallmarked solid silver leaf and scroll engraved vesta case, with interesting diagonally seamed cover, and match strike to lower edge.
Vesta cases are airtight cases made to contain short friction matches and keep them safe and dry. They were made in many materials, and some in precious metals like this one, usually with gilt linings, to protect against corrosion from the match heads. They were widely made and used from 1890-1920. Many had a loop attached, like this one, to attach to an albert chain. Now, they are very collectable and interesting small antique silver items.
